Close to Hiroshima, Chugoku Jozo has been producing a range of liquors, sakes and shochus for almost a century, with their first blended whisky being released in 1990.
The raw materials are carefully selected by the Master Blender, following scrupulous criteria and attention to detail. He then personally takes care of the maturation and blending processes, adding his own special Japanese touch.
Maturation takes place within a unique setting - a 361 metre long tunnel dating back to 1970, offering a constant temperature of 14C and 80% humidity - the perfect ageing conditions.
Togouchi 18 year old is similar to Scottish Lowland whisky, famed for its floral and malted notes. A rounded texture and complex aromatic profile express themselves through intense fruity and woody notes.
Produced from 60% grain and 40% malt whisky and tunnel-matured for 18 years.
Tasting Notes
Nose: smooth aromas of peach and pear
Palate: a powerful and balanced blend of white pepper, malted cereals and violets
Finish: dry and lingering notes of pine nuts and sunflower seeds
